Common Sleep Disorders Treated by a Sleep Therapist
A sleep specialist is equipped to handle a wide variety of sleep-related concerns. Allow's take a closer check out several of the most typical conditions they can aid with:
1. Rest Wake Disorder
This disorder includes an inequality in between your body's body clock and the external environment, commonly leading to difficulties in preserving a routine rest timetable. A rest specialist can aid you straighten your body clock through light treatment, behavior changes, and leisure techniques.
2. Narcolepsy Treatment
Narcolepsy is a neurological condition that causes excessive daytime sleepiness and sudden muscle weakness (cataplexy). A sleep therapist works closely with a rest medication medical professional to develop an administration strategy, which may include behavioral approaches and drug changes.
3. Parasomnia Treatment
Parasomnias are disruptive sleep behaviors, such as sleepwalking, problems, or rest speaking. While these behaviors can be unsettling, they are treatable. A rest specialist commonly utilizes techniques to identify triggers and lower episodes, especially with sleep talking therapy or other targeted therapies.
4. Hypersomnia Treatment
Hypersomnia entails extreme sleepiness throughout the day, even after a full evening's rest. A sleep specialist examines potential underlying reasons, such as way of life factors, clinical conditions, or mental tension, and develops approaches to handle too much sleepiness.
5. Sleep problems
One of one of the most common rest disorders, sleep problems is defined by trouble falling or remaining asleep. CBT-I, great post delivered by an sleeplessness doctor or sleep specialist, is just one of the most reliable treatments offered.
Just How Sleep Therapists Approach Treatment
The work of a sleep specialist entails various evidence-based methods customized to the distinct demands of each patient. Below are a few of one of the most usual methods used in sleep therapy:
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y for Insomnia (CBT-I)
CBT-I is a foundation of rest treatment. It concentrates on identifying and altering believed patterns and habits that hinder rest. As an example, you could:
- Develop a regular going to bed regimen.
- Learn relaxation techniques to manage pre-sleep anxiety.
- Reframe negative thoughts about rest.
Way Of Living and Behavioral Modifications
A rest specialist may suggest changes to your everyday routines, such as:
- Avoiding caffeine or heavy meals before bed.
- Establishing a relaxing bedtime regimen.
- Restricting display time in the evening.
Education and Support
Many people take advantage of comprehending their condition. A sleep specialist supplies resources and guidance to encourage you to handle your sleep issues effectively. This is specifically handy for problems like sleep wake problem or narcolepsy, where continuous education can boost results.
Collaboration with Other Specialists
In many cases, a sleep specialist jobs alongside various other professionals, such as rest disorder medical professionals or an sleeplessness doctor, to make sure a detailed approach to therapy. For example, a sleep medication doctor might provide medicines while the specialist focuses on behavioral modifications.

Self-Help Tips to Complement Sleep Therapy
While dealing with a sleep specialist, you can embrace these self-help methods to improve your sleep wellness:
- Stick to a Sleep Schedule: Go to bed and awaken at the same time everyday, also on weekends.
- Develop a Sleep-Friendly Environment: Keep your bed room cool, dark, and quiet.
- Exercise Relaxation Techniques: Deep breathing, meditation, or progressive muscular tissue relaxation can aid you loosen up before bed.
- Display Your Sleep Habits: Keep a journal to track your sleep patterns and recognize triggers.
- Limitation Stimulants: Avoid caffeine and pure nicotine in the hours leading up to bedtime.
